Princeton fire firefighters were dispatched to a motor vehicle accident and while en route crews were notified the vehicle had rolled, and extrication was needed. Engine crews arrived on the scene and found a tractor-trailer had rolled onto the driver’s side along County Road 350 South. Crews implemented a very intricate extrication, but Princeton firefighter crews were able to successfully get the driver out without further injury.

County Road 350 South in Gibson County was closed for several hours Wednesday morning as crews worked to free a driver trapped inside a semi-truck.
